According to David Fox, "The large number of mazes was the best way to make the game as big as possible without needing an additional disk."

Maniac Mansion is tiny and it's still the superior game. Mazes would have been okay by themselves, but they went out of their way to make some of them as obnoxious as possible. Like in the one in the Face of Mars, which must be navigated in the dark AND with a limited oxygen supply.
The worst bit is that they made one of the characters in Mars "afraid of heights" just so there's a chance you unknowingly decide to use HER to explore the maze, and when you find the climate machine it turns out you can't activate it and have to do it over with the other character.
